Based on the Spanish table from 1984, Flashman, by Sportmatic.
 
shannon1: all the graphics and directb2s
jpsalas: VPX table
 
I included the rom in the download, flashman.zip, because it wasn't in the roms section.
Also included two wheels by teisen, thanks my friend :)

I forgot to explain that if you want the apron cards in Spanish, then find in the script Const UseSpanishCards = False and change it to True

If you want the table darker you can always use CTRL LEFT + CTRL RIGHT (the magnasave buttons) and it will get darker

(keep the left magnasave down and scroll through the steps with the right magnasave)
